A healthcare organization in Doncaster seeks a peer support worker with lived experience in mental health to join their Home Treatment Team. You will support service users in community settings, facilitate peer support groups, and assist with recovery-focused activities. This role also offers an opportunity to undertake a Level 3 apprenticeship to develop skills needed for a successful health services career.

An exciting opportunity has arisen for a peer support worker with lived experience to join the Home Treatment Team/Crisis Team. The post holder is required to work with service users with mental health needs to promote recovery, support connections and reduce isolation.
Rotherham Doncaster and South Humber NHS Foundation Trust (RDaSH) employs around 4,000 colleagues who are valued and respected. The Trust’s portfolio includes mental health, physical health, learning disability and drug and alcohol services. The organisation is committed to developing its people and holds a learning half day every month for colleagues. RDaSH aims to provide first-class care while remaining aligned with its vision and values.
